Stocks gain over N960bn in 4-day trading week

Nigeria’s equities market value rose remarkably by N966billion in the four-day trading week ended Friday April 25. Analysts see the first-quarter (Q1) earnings season providing catalyst for continued investor engagement, with strong corporate performances driving buy-side interest from stock investors. Tribunal upholds FCCPC’s $220m fine against Meta

The Competition and Consumer Protection Tribunal has upheld the $220 million fine levied against Meta Platforms Inc. by the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Commission (FCCPC).
